Hello community,
here is the log from the commit of package hplip
checked in at Fri Jan 12 17:12:29 CET 2007.
--------
--- hplip/hplip.changes 2006-12-20 15:16:13.000000000 +0100
+++ /mounts/work_src_done/STABLE/hplip/hplip.changes 2007-01-12 15:19:07.000000000 +0100
@@ -1,0 +2,9 @@
+Fri Jan 12 15:13:35 CET 2007 - jsmeix@suse.de
+
+- Since version 1.6.12 /usr/bin/hpijs is linked with libcups
+ so that the package hplip-hpijs could be no longer installed
+ without at least the package cups-libs. Therefore an additional
+ special /usr/bin/hpijs.without-libcups is built which does not
+ require the CUPS library.
+
+-------------------------------------------------------------------
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Other differences:
------------------
++++++ hplip.spec ++++++
--- /var/tmp/diff_new_pack.s13290/_old 2007-01-12 17:12:08.000000000 +0100
+++ /var/tmp/diff_new_pack.s13290/_new 2007-01-12 17:12:08.000000000 +0100
@@ -1,7 +1,7 @@
#
# spec file for package hplip (Version 1.6.12)
#
-# Copyright (c) 2006 SUSE LINUX Products GmbH, Nuernberg, Germany.
+# Copyright (c) 2007 SUSE LINUX Products GmbH, Nuernberg, Germany.
# This file and all modifications and additions to the pristine
# package are under the same license as the package itself.
#
@@ -17,10 +17,10 @@
# x.y.m : x = major release number, y = year (eg: 6 = 2006), m = month (eg: 6a = second release in June)
# Official releases have a 3 digit number and release candidates have a 4 digit number: x.y.m.rc
Version: 1.6.12
-Release: 1
+Release: 11
%define hpijsVersion 2.6.12
Group: Hardware/Printing
-License: BSD License and BSD-like, Other License(s), see package
+License: BSD License and BSD-like, GNU General Public License (GPL)
URL: http://hpinkjet.sourceforge.net/
# URL for Source0: http://superb-west.dl.sourceforge.net/sourceforge/hplip/hplip-1.6.12.tar.gz
Source0: %{name}-%{version}.tar.bz2
@@ -135,6 +135,26 @@
# Set -fstack-protector-all to enable "Stack Protector" via a so called "canary" (requires gcc >= 4.1):
export CFLAGS="$RPM_OPT_FLAGS -fstack-protector-all"
export CXXFLAGS="$RPM_OPT_FLAGS -fno-strict-aliasing -fstack-protector-all"
+# First of all build a special hpijs which does not require the CUPS library.
+# One of the HPLIP authors David Suffield told me in a mail:
+# > To: Johannes Meixner
participants (1)
-
root@Hilbert.suse.de